Fusicoccum canker of almond
Diaporthe amygdali
Description
The disease is caused by the fungal pathogen Diaporthe amygdali, with Fusicoccum amygdali as its asexual state. This fungus is a significant threat to almond orchards worldwide, known for causing severe cankers that eventually lead to the dieback of entire branches and the decline of the tree canopy.
While almonds are the primary host, the pathogen also affects other stone fruit trees, including peaches and nectarines. The disease targets the woody parts of the tree, focusing on buds, twigs, and larger branches, effectively cutting off nutrient and water supply to the distal parts of the plant.
Early symptoms include dark, sunken lesions surrounding leaf scars or dormant buds. As the infection progresses, these lesions expand into elongated cankers, often accompanied by gum exudation (gummosis). Eventually, the leaves distal to the canker wilt, turn brown, and remain attached to the affected twig.
The development of Diaporthe amygdali is strongly linked to humidity and rainfall patterns. Spores are dispersed by splashing water and wind, entering the tree through natural openings, wounds caused by insects, or mechanical damage from pruning and frost cracks, which serve as primary entry points.
Integrated management is essential for control, starting with the prompt removal and burning of all infected wood to reduce the inoculum level in the orchard. Implementing strict hygiene practices during pruning, followed by the application of copper-based bactericides or site-specific fungicides, helps protect sensitive tissue from new infections.
